#182549 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#182549 is composed of 9.4% red, 14.5%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 224.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 19%. #182549 color hex could be obtained by blending #304a92 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#182549 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#182549 has RGB values of R:24, G:37,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 1582409.

Shades and Tints of #182549
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05070e is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#182549
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e3033 is the less saturated color, while #021a5f is the most saturated one.
